body .products-with-hotshot__container{display:flex;flex-direction:column-reverse;gap:0}@media(min-width: 1024px){body .products-with-hotshot__container{display:grid;grid-template-columns:350px calc(100% - 350px - 20px);grid-template-rows:1fr;gap:20px}}body .products-with-hotshot__container>*{width:100%}body .products-with-hotshot__left{display:flex;flex-direction:column}body .products-with-hotshot__right>*:nth-child(2){margin-top:-10px;height:fit-content}body .products-with-hotshot__right .products-section__slider{border-top:2px solid #e0dad1;border-bottom:2px solid #e0dad1}body .hotshot-card{padding:8px;border:2px solid #e07c35;border-radius:8px}body .hotshot-card__inner{display:grid;grid-template-columns:auto;grid-template-rows:auto auto;gap:0;transition:background .1s ease-in-out;border-radius:8px;padding:12px}@media(min-width: 481px){body .hotshot-card__inner{grid-template-columns:50% auto;grid-template-rows:1fr;gap:20px}}@media(min-width: 640px){body .hotshot-card__inner{gap:30px}}@media(min-width: 1024px){body .hotshot-card__inner{grid-template-columns:auto;grid-template-rows:auto auto;gap:0}}body .hotshot-card__inner:hover{background-color:#fff}body .hotshot-card__inner:hover .hotshot-card__button{border-color:#b7a894}body .hotshot-card__first{height:fit-content;height:auto}@media(min-width: 481px){body .hotshot-card__first{max-width:250px}}@media(min-width: 640px){body .hotshot-card__first{max-width:unset}}body .hotshot-card__image,body .hotshot-card__img{width:100%;border-radius:8px}@media(max-width: 480px){body .hotshot-card__image,body .hotshot-card__img{max-height:175px}}body .hotshot-card__image{position:relative;background-color:#fff;padding:4px;display:flex;justify-content:center;align-items:center;height:100%}body .hotshot-card__image a{width:100%;height:100%}body .hotshot-card__img{max-width:100%;width:100%;height:auto;max-height:100%;object-fit:contain}@media(min-width: 390px){body .hotshot-card__img{max-width:320px}}@media(min-width: 641px){body .hotshot-card__img{max-width:400px}}@media(min-width: 1024px){body .hotshot-card__img{max-width:100%}}body .hotshot-card .bs24-badge-list{top:5px;left:5px;right:unset}body .hotshot-card__discount-badge{content:"";background-color:#e07c35;width:max-content;color:#fff;font-size:10px;font-weight:600;text-align:center;text-wrap:nowrap;border-radius:8px;padding:2px 4px;pointer-events:none;background-color:#c5312d;padding:4px 8px;font-size:14px;text-wrap:nowrap}@media(min-width: 641px){body .hotshot-card__discount-badge{padding:4px 8px;font-size:14px;text-wrap:unset}}body .hotshot-card__product-name{font-size:16px;font-weight:600;line-height:1.5;margin:8px 0 4px}body .hotshot-card__bottom{margin-top:12px;display:grid;grid-template-columns:1fr;grid-template-rows:1fr auto;align-items:center;gap:8px}@media(min-width: 481px){body .hotshot-card__bottom{grid-template-columns:1fr;grid-template-rows:auto auto}}body .hotshot-card__info{display:flex;flex-direction:column;height:fit-content}body .hotshot-card__prices{font-size:22px;font-weight:700}body .hotshot-card__prices del{font-weight:700;opacity:.7;color:#e07c35}body .hotshot-card__prices del *{font-weight:inherit}body .hotshot-card__old-price-note{font-size:12px;font-weight:300;display:block}body .hotshot-card__stock-info{margin-top:8px}body .hotshot-card__countdown{max-width:280px;margin-top:0;background-color:#f5f3f0;border:#fff;border-radius:8px;text-align:center}body .hotshot-card__countdown-header{padding:6px 0 4px}body .hotshot-card__timer{display:grid;grid-template-columns:1fr 1fr 1fr;padding:0;max-width:250px;width:100%;margin:0 auto}body .hotshot-card__timer>div{display:flex;flex-direction:column;justify-content:center;align-items:center;aspect-ratio:1/1;width:100%;height:auto;border-right:1px solid #b7a894}body .hotshot-card__timer>div:last-child{border-right:none}body .hotshot-card__timer-number{font-size:24px;font-weight:600}@media(min-width: 1024px){body .hotshot-card__timer-number{font-size:24px}}@media(min-width: 895px){body .hotshot-card__timer-number{font-size:50px}}@media(min-width: 795px){body .hotshot-card__timer-number{font-size:32px}}@media(min-width: 480px){body .hotshot-card__timer-number{font-size:24px}}@media(min-width: 360px){body .hotshot-card__timer-number{font-size:50px}}@media(min-width: 320px){body .hotshot-card__timer-number{font-size:32px}}body .hotshot-card__timer-caption{font-size:14px;font-weight:300}body .hotshot-card__button-wrapper{flex:1;height:100%;display:flex;align-items:flex-end;border-radius:8px;margin-top:0px}@media(min-width: 481px){body .hotshot-card__button-wrapper{height:auto;flex:unset}}body .hotshot-card__button{width:100%;height:fit-content;text-align:center;background-color:#fff;border:4px solid #fff;transition:all .3 ease-in-out;border-radius:8px;transition:background .2s ease-in-out,transform .2s ease-in-out,box-shadow .2s ease-in-out}body .hotshot-card__button:hover{background:linear-gradient(to right, white, rgb(203.5139664804, 192.7877094972, 178.4860335196));transform:translateY(-2px);box-shadow:0 4px 12px rgba(0,0,0,.15)}body .hotshot-card__button:hover{border-color:#b7a894}body #near-hotshot-slider-mobile{display:none}@media(max-width: 1023px){body #near-hotshot-slider-mobile{display:block}}body .products-section:has(#near-hotshot-slider-mobile){display:none}@media(max-width: 1023px){body .products-section:has(#near-hotshot-slider-mobile){display:block}}body .products-section:has(#near-hotshot-slider-1),body .products-section:has(#near-hotshot-slider-2){display:block}@media(max-width: 1023px){body .products-section:has(#near-hotshot-slider-1),body .products-section:has(#near-hotshot-slider-2){display:none}}
